    Notable iEnergy Company Logos in Australia

    Let's zoom in on some notable iEnergy company logos in Australia. We'll break down what makes them tick and what messages they're trying to send. We're talking about the big players, the innovators, and the ones making waves in the renewable energy scene.

    First off, consider a company like AGL Energy. Their logo, while more traditional, uses a strong, recognizable font and often incorporates colors that evoke stability and reliability. It's all about conveying a sense of trust and long-term commitment to energy solutions. Then there's Origin Energy, whose logo is often seen with a dynamic design, suggesting movement and forward progress. This reflects their focus on innovation and adapting to the changing energy landscape. Snowy Hydro, another key player, often uses imagery that represents their connection to nature and their role in harnessing hydroelectric power. Their logo typically features elements like water and mountains, symbolizing their commitment to sustainable energy generation.

    The Psychology Behind iEnergy Logos

    Alright, let's get a bit psycho-analytical. What's the psychology behind iEnergy logos? Colors, shapes, and fonts all play a role in how we perceive these companies. It's like a visual language that speaks to our subconscious.

    Color is a powerful tool. Green often represents nature, growth, and sustainability. Blue can evoke feelings of trust, stability, and reliability. Yellow might suggest energy, optimism, and innovation. Companies carefully select their color palettes to align with the messages they want to convey. Shape also matters. Circular logos can represent unity, harmony, and completeness, while angular shapes might convey strength, stability, and precision. The font used in a logo can also have a significant impact. A clean, modern font can suggest efficiency and innovation, while a more traditional font might convey a sense of history and trustworthiness. When you combine all these elements, you get a logo that speaks volumes about the company and its values. The goal is to create a visual identity that resonates with customers and helps build a strong brand reputation.

    Before you finalize your logo, make sure it is scalable and versatile. It should look good on a variety of platforms and in different sizes, from business cards to billboards. Consider how your logo will appear in black and white and ensure it is still recognizable without color. Protect your logo by registering it as a trademark. This will prevent other companies from using a similar logo and help you build a strong brand identity. Moreover, regularly review and update your logo as your company evolves and grows. A fresh and modern logo can help you stay relevant and competitive in the ever-changing iEnergy market.
